A 46-year-old man has been killed in a crash in Kells in Co Meath.
He died when the van he was driving collided with a lorry at Johnsbrook on the N52 at 10.30am this morning.
He was pronounced dead at scene.
A 66-year-old man who was driving the lorry was taken to Navan Hospital with non life-threatening injuries.
The road is closed for a forensic investigation and motorists are being advised that diversions are in place.
Gardaí are appealing for any witnesses to the crash to come forward.
